Почувствуй разницу
Боевые ходули: украинские катера оказались ржавыми
Пограничники российские спасли несчастных, а то поубивались бы.
Утрись и не вякай;)
В Керчи разобрали украинские бронекатера проекта «Гюрза», задержанные в 2018 году. «Гордость Украины», с помощью которой киевские политики собирались отвоевать Крым, оказалась рухлядью.
— IZ.RU (@izvestia_ru)pic.twitter.com/mOwECwINXK
22 марта 2019 г.
Чего должны были «спрашивать»? Люди с незачехленными железяками перлись в российские территориальные воды как на буфет. Несмотря на многократные предупреждения. Пограничники могли их отправить к праотцам и были бы абсолютно правы. А потом и вовсе бросились наутёк. «Тикайте, хлопцы!» Неадекваты.
Похоже сейчас в школе вообще ничему не учат...
Водоизмещение корабля (судна) — одна из основных характеристик любого водного транспортного средства: общее количество воды, вытесненной подводной частью корпуса корабля (судна). Масса этого количества жидкости равна массе всего корабля, независимо от его размера, материала и формы.
Так что автор перевода с курсом арифметики начальной школы знаком :)))
Да реально пофиг, я не помню, какой там символ в русском языке отделяет дробную часть, а какой тысячи, а в английском запятая тысячи, а точка дробную часть. Вы походу тоже не знаете, так как в одном комментарии у вас запятая, а в другом точка...
Да реально пофиг,я не помню, какой там символ в русском языке отделяет дробную часть, а какой тысячи
Вот за это и двойка за курс арифметики начальной школы!
На счет меня — вообще-то в моих коментах здесь стоит точка между целой и дробной частью в соответся с синтаксисом алголоподобных языков программирования — увы, профессиональноая привычка.
Вы походу тоже не знаете, так как в одном комментарии у вас запятая, а в другом точка...
Прошу показать, где у меня в комментариях по данной новости целая и дробная часть числа отделены запятой?
В английской локалке "," — digital grouping symbol, "." — decimal symbol, а русской локалке " " — digital grouping symbol, а "," — decimal symbol. Так что вам вместе с переводчиком ставим неуд и по арифметике, и по программированию.
Если для программиста новость, что есть такое понятие, как Culture или Locale (в разных языках это называется по разному), то говно такой программист. Из-за таких говнокодеров потом спутники падают в Тихий Океан, и цены вбивают с ошибками в несколько тысяч и т.д.
Если для программиста новость, что есть такое понятие, как Culture или Locale (в разных языках это называется по разному)
Поищи такое в стандартах чего-нибудь типа С++, Delphi и т.п. Или хотя бы в php
Такое может ляпнуть только действительно опущеный
C++: http://www.cplusplus.com/reference/locale/
А по поводу остального… Забудь этот древний хлам, он давно уже никому не нужен...
«Умник»!
Ты мне в с++ вот такой оператор пожалуйста оттранслируй
float ff = 2,564;
И скажи, что на выходе получишь? А?
А на счет
Или хотя бы в php....
Ты со своей фразе
А по поводу остального… Забудь этот древний хлам, он давно уже никому не нужен...
Ты это здесь у админа спроси, как он к этому отнесется? Если ты php древним ненужным хламом считаешь, что же ты сюда на этот ресурс приперся, он же в большей части на нем, родимом написан!
И после этого ты не считаешь себя опущеным? Считаешь себя «крутым компьюторщиком», «икспертом»?
А ты чей бот?
Где ты разговор про операторы и константы нашел? Ты так же уныл, как и придурок олежка, который осилил 100 лет назад книжку for beginners, и мнит из себя не в рот еб**ть пизт**тым гуру. Он привык, му-ха-ха. Кто тебя просил выступить в роли его адвоката?
Я на эту желтушную помойку пришел, когда пхп был вполне актуален. Еще до того, когда этот сайт скатился в бложик нескольких либералов и ватников, которые тащут сюда свякую х***ню из непроверенных источников. Захожу сюда только посмотреть на дно упала российская журналистика… P.S. эту помойку давно пора с нуля переписать. Уж больно она кривая и глюченная...
Ты лучше признайся чей ты бот? стренажа? прецедента? Или кто-то из них твой бот? А то что-то на лексикон либералов и ватников перешел
А на счет компов те нужно хотя бы теже самые книжки почитать, что бы матчасть освоить, в который ты себя икспертом мнишь
Я же тебе написал примерчик на c++ или ты его с паскалем перпутал? Ай-ай-ай!
Как не хорошо! Хотя что с человека взять, который не знает разницы между исходным текстом софта и интерфейсом линукса
Хотя ты мне с запятой работающий пример исходного текста на джаве или питоне приведешь? Про sql не говорю, для такого иксперта это видимо старое гавно, которое никому не нужно?
package javaapplication1;
public class JavaApplication1 {
public static void main(String[] args) {
for (int i = 0; i < args.length — 1; i++)
{
if (args[i].compareTo("--ships_displace") == 0) {
try {
java.util.Locale ruRuLocale = new java.util.Locale.Builder().setLanguage(«ru»).setRegion(«RU»).build();
java.util.Locale enUsLocale = new java.util.Locale.Builder().setLanguage(«en»).setRegion(«US»).build();
double shipsDisplace = (double) java.text.NumberFormat.getNumberInstance(ruRuLocale).parse(args[i + 1]);
System.out.println(«result in ru_RU locale: » + java.text.NumberFormat.getNumberInstance(ruRuLocale).format(shipsDisplace));
System.out.println(«result in en_US locale: » + java.text.NumberFormat.getNumberInstance(enUsLocale).format(shipsDisplace));
} catch (java.text.ParseException ex) {
System.out.println(ex.getMessage());
}
}
}
}
}
Сайт этот говно коченное. Если кавычки поменяешь, можешь скомпилировать и порадоваться исключению, когда подашь вместо запятой свою сраную точку...
И что? Где в твоем примере запятая? Ты вот сюда поставь свою «локаль» и посмотри, что будет
for (float i =1,008; i < args.length — 1,045; ...
А то что ты наворотил — это работа с внешнем интерфейсом программы, а не написание исходников.
Так что еще раз, для бестолковых - что с человека взять, который не знает разницы между исходным текстом софта и интерфейсом линукса
Да слейся ты уже, ну ей богу, надоел свой безграмотностью. Какой тебе в жопу линукс? Ты отчибучил, что все ЯП всегда используется точка (про константы вообще никто не упоминал), тебе доказали, что это не так (прикинь на баше тоже программируют всякие скрипты), ты со своим ботом уверял, что в яве нет локалей, получи и распишись. Кстати, твоя строчка кода даже не скомпилируется на яве, клоун, и даже не из-за запятой в константе...
Безгармотный как раз ты! Ты путаешь интерфейс с исходным текстом.
Ты отчибучил, что все ЯП всегда используется точка
А вот это по-подробнее, где я такое говорил с цитатокой и ссылочкой! Речь кроме как про исходный текст нигде не шла! Причем об этом повторяюсь какждый раз!
Так что сливаться нужно тебе, который путает исходный текст с обрабатываемыми данными.
ты со своим ботом уверял, что в яве нет локалей, получи и распишись
И где же я это говорил? Цитату и ссылку!
Кстати, твоя строчка кода даже не скомпилируется на яве, клоун, и даже не из-за запятой в константе...
Ну так я ее полностью и не выписывал, только принцип. И мне простительно — я с ней никогда и не работал :)))
Так что сливайся!
Ты даже не понял, где твоя ошибка:
В Яве 1.008 — имеет тип double, а 1.008f — float. В яве нельзя присвоить переменной типа float константу типа double без конвертации во float.
float i = 1.008; выдаст ошибку, должно быть
или
float i = (float)1.008;
или
float i = 1.008f;
или
double i = 1.008;
Так что иди кури мануалы и не парь мозг.
Ага! Слился!
float i = 1.008; выдаст ошибку, должно быть
или
float i = (float)1.008;
или
float i = 1.008f;
Т.е. сам признал, что как бы с локалью не манипулировал, все равно точка должна быть! Т.е. как ты сочиняешь
float i = (float)1,008; или float i = 1,008f;
Работать не будут! Что и требовалось доказать!
Перечитай внимательно. Ты стал отрицать обратное.
ТыцНа счет меня — вообще-то в моих коментах здесь стоит точка между целой и дробной частью в соответся с синтаксисом алголоподобных языков программирования
Твой ответ
Так что вам вместе с переводчиком ставим неуд и по арифметике, и по программированию.
И далее от меня
Посмотрел бы я, как ты прогу где дробная часть отделена запятой будешь транслировать и воображать, что у тебя что-то получится, если ты сменишь локалку
Твой ответ
Если для программиста новость,что есть такое понятие, как Culture или Locale (в разных языках это называется по разному)...
Зачитывание данных и парсинг — это, как бы, одна из важных частей, где херача по привычке и игнорируя локали можно понатворить делов. Еще раз, где цитата про константы?
Проссыс! У тебя глаза мутные! Я тебе 4 штуки привел!
Тебе четко сказали и про синтаксис и про исходный текст. А ты мне скажи, где в исходном тексте дробные числа пишутся, кроме как в константе? Если скажешь, что строке — так извини, это текст, он в ковычках все терпит.
На вскидку -
— расчетные формулы
— цкилы, когда шаг меньше единицы
— if'ы с дробной развилкой по вычисляемому результату
Можно еще кучу привести
И часто это остается в коде, а не переносится в кофиги и т.п.? Что это за магическое число в коде, которое определяет по какой развилке идти? С натуральными числами все понятно, это сплошь и рядом, а вот с дробными?
Ты предлагаешь выносить расчетную формулу в конфиг????
Что это за магическое число в коде, которое определяет по какой развилке идти?
Тебе что задачу придумывать? Или ты никогда не встречал, что при некотором значении промежуточного параметра дальнейший расчет идет или по одной формуле или по другой? И в зависимости от расчета это может быть любое действительное число, определяемое заданным алгоритмом.
И часто это остается в коде, а не переносится в кофиги и т.п.?
Ты предлагаешь некий параметр, который ты заранее знаешь, что они никогда меняться не будет запихивать в конфиг? И на фига такой гимор?
Ладно, признаю, что про два по программированию было неудачной шуткой, на этом и заканчиваем. Сам я никогда не использую тип double или float, потому, что ты, например, ожидажешь, что код:
if (199750001.11 / 100.0 == 1997500.0111)
System.out.println(«true»);
else
System.out.println(«false»);
отпечатает слово true, а на самом деле будет false, так как ява при делении 199750001.11 на 100 получает 1997500.0111000002, и подобной магии из-за несовершенства этого типа просто вагон...
так как ява при делении 199750001.11 на 100 получает 1997500.0111000002, и подобной магии из-за несовершенства этого типа просто вагон...
И не только в ней.
Согласен. Приколов много. Помню класически пример был — сумма, которая зависит от того, в каком порядке суммируются числа.
Еще по поводу запятой. Постоянно вижу на ценниках в магазинах мониторы и телевизоры с разрешением экрана 3,840 x 2,160, и это с учетом, что в Литве запятая по правилам в математике используется, как в России :D
Видимо локаль нормально не настроена, а может прога какая-то без использовании локали фигачет напрямую.
Кстати сегодня пришлось немного с кое-чем из этой области повозиться. Проставлялось время не +3 как вроде бы должно, а +4 :(((
А по своей ссылочки ты хотя бы прочитал, о чем там говорится. Ты хоть тыкне в то место, что в исходном тексте программы для действительной константы можно в ней вместо точки запятую написать. Так что «знатока» из себя не строй